A Swift-based library for composable logging, built on swift-log. It helps you shape how they look, structured exactly the way you want.
A template that defines the shape of a log line — configure it once and it applies to every event.
import Lily
let formatter = LogFormatter([
.timestamp,
" ",
.level {
render, _ in
render().padding(toLength: 8, withPad: " ", startingAt: 0)
},
.when({ !$0.label.isEmpty }, then: [" ", .label]),
" ",
.message,
" ",
.group(["[", .source, "]"]),
.when({ $0.event.metadata?.isEmpty == false }, then: [": ", .metadata]),
])
StreamLogHandler.standardOutput(label: label, formatter: formatter)2026-07-29T01:35:23+0700 info lily Compiling Lily with 47 files [LilyDemo]: target=Lily
2026-07-29T01:35:23+0700 warning lily Value 'temp' never mutated, use 'let' [LilyDemo]
2026-07-29T01:35:23+0700 error lily No such module 'MissingDependency' [LilyDemo]: module=MissingDependency
2026-07-29T01:35:23+0700 critical lily Segfault at 0x7ffeebad, address not mapped [LilyDemo]
LogFormatter.standard produces output that matches swift-log's StreamLogHandler default format.
StreamLogHandler.standardOutput(label: label, formatter: .standard)Components — all available log line building blocks
| Component | Description |
|---|---|
.timestamp |
The formatted timestamp string prepared by the handler |
.level |
The log level (e.g. info, warning, error) |
.label |
The logger label (e.g. com.example.MyApp) |
.message |
The log message |
.metadata |
All metadata key-value pairs |
.metadata(including:) |
Only selected metadata keys |
.metadata(excluding:) |
All metadata except specified keys |
.metadata(key:) |
A single metadata value by key |
.source |
The swift-log event source |
.file |
The call-site file path |
.function |
The call-site function name |
.line |
The call-site line number |
.literal("...") |
Static text |
.group([...]) |
Child components rendered consecutively |
.joined([...], separator:) |
Non-empty children joined by separator |
.when(_:then:) |
Child components rendered only when predicate is true |
Each component also supports a formattedBy: variant for custom formatting closures.
Add color with Rainbow
import Rainbow
let formatter = LogFormatter([
.timestamp { render, _ in render().dim },
" ",
.level { render, context in
let level = render().padding(toLength: 8, withPad: " ", startingAt: 0).uppercased()
return switch context.event.level {
case .debug: level.blue
case .info: level.cyan
case .warning: level.yellow
case .error: level.red
case .critical: level.onRed
default: level.dim
}
},
.when(
{ !$0.label.isEmpty },
then: [
" ",
.label { render, context in
let label = render() // handle color support yourself without Rainbow
return context.supportsColor ? "\u{1B}[35m\(label)\u{1B}[0m" : label
},
]
),
" ",
.message,
" ",
.group(["[", .source, "]"]),
" ",
.when({ $0.event.metadata?.isEmpty == false }, then: [": ", .metadata]),
])
StreamLogHandler.standardOutput(label: label, formatter: formatter)Each component accepts an optional formattedBy: closure with access to the rendering context — letting you apply ANSI color, reorder fields, or transform values however you like.
A named predicate in a handler's pipeline — each event either passes through or gets dropped.
let filter = LogFilter(name: "min-level") { event in
event.level >= .warning ? event : nil
}
var handler = StreamLogHandler.standardOutput(label: label)
handler.addFilter(filter)Filters run in the order they were added. If any filter returns nil, the event is dropped immediately.
addFilter(_:) is a no-op and returns false if a filter with the same name already exists.
Reusable filter structs
struct NoiseSuppressor: LogFiltering {
var name: String { "discord-kit-noise" }
func filter(_ event: LogEvent) -> LogEvent? {
guard case .warning = event.level,
event.source == "DiscordKit",
event.message.description.contains("referencing an unknown")
else { return event }
return nil
}
}
let handler = StreamLogHandler.standardOutput(
label: label,
filters: [NoiseSuppressor()]
)Two approaches — LogFilter for quick one-off closures, LogFiltering for reusable filter structs.

// Package.swift
dependencies: [
.package(url: "https://github.com/staciax/lily.git", from: "0.1.0")
],
targets: [
.target(name: "MyApp", dependencies: [
.product(name: "Lily", package: "lily"),
])
